Understanding the Purpose of Articles of Organization

You’re starting a business and want to know the ins and outs of creating a legal entity – this section will guide you through the purpose behind Articles of Organization.

Essentially, Articles of Organization are a set of legal documents that define your business as its own separate entity. This means that your personal assets won’t be at risk if your business faces any financial or legal troubles.

In Louisiana, there are specific regulations that must be followed when filing Articles of Organization. For instance, you’ll need to choose a unique name for your business and register it with the Secretary of State’s office. Additionally, you’ll need to include important information about your business in the document, such as its purpose, address, and management structure.

It’s important to consult with an attorney before filing these documents because they can help ensure that everything is done correctly. An attorney can help you understand what type of legal entity would be best for your particular situation and make sure all necessary details are included in the Articles of Organization.

Pros and Cons of LLCs

LLCs can offer both advantages and disadvantages, so it’s important to weigh them carefully before making a decision.

On the one hand, LLCs provide flexibility in management structure and taxation options. They also offer personal liability protection for owners, separating business assets from personal ones. Additionally, LLCs allow for easy transfer of ownership interests and may have better access to financing due to their perceived stability.

On the other hand, there are potential drawbacks to forming an LLC. These include increased paperwork requirements and administrative costs compared to other business structures. Additionally, some states may require annual fees or minimum taxes regardless of profit levels. Furthermore, the lack of clear legal precedent on certain issues related to LLCs may create uncertainty in certain situations.

Considering these factors is essential when deciding whether an LLC is the right choice for your business.

Tax Implications

Don’t overlook the potential tax consequences of forming an LLC – it could mean more money in your pocket or a hefty bill from Uncle Sam. LLCs are generally considered pass-through entities for tax purposes, meaning that the company’s income is passed through to its owners and taxed at their individual rates. This can be advantageous if your personal tax rate is lower than the corporate tax rate, but it also means you’ll need to stay on top of IRS compliance requirements.

Failing to comply with IRS regulations can result in penalties and fines, which can quickly add up and cut into your profits. Additionally, some states impose additional taxes or fees on LLCs, so it’s important to research these potential costs before deciding whether to form an LLC. Consulting with an attorney who specializes in business law can help ensure that you’re aware of all the potential tax consequences and comply with all necessary regulations.

Legal Terminology and Requirements

You’ll want to make sure you understand the legal terms and requirements for forming an LLC in Louisiana before moving forward with the process. It’s important to have a basic understanding of legal jargon and document preparation, as this will help ensure that your articles of organization meet all necessary legal standards.

Here are five key things to keep in mind as you begin this process:

  • Make sure you choose a unique name for your LLC that complies with Louisiana’s naming rules.
  • Be prepared to file articles of organization with the Secretary of State’s office, along with any required fees.
  • Consider drafting an operating agreement that outlines how your business will be run, including management structure and decision-making procedures.
  • Keep in mind that Louisiana requires LLCs to appoint a registered agent who can receive legal documents on behalf of the company.
  • Finally, be aware of any tax obligations associated with forming an LLC in Louisiana.

By understanding these requirements upfront, you can avoid costly mistakes and setbacks down the road.

Filing the Articles of Organization

To properly establish your business in the state, it’s crucial to understand the process involved in officially registering it. One of the essential steps is filing the articles of organization with the Louisiana Secretary of State’s office. The articles serve as a legal document that outlines your business structure and operations.

Here are some key things to keep in mind when filing the articles of organization:

  • Filing requirements: Make sure you meet all filing requirements, including paying any necessary fees and submitting all required forms.
  • Business name: Choose a unique name for your business that complies with Louisiana naming guidelines.
  • Registered agent: Designate a registered agent who can receive important legal documents on behalf of your company.
  • Member information: Provide accurate information about members or managers of your LLC and their roles within the company.
  • Common mistakes: Avoid common mistakes such as not providing complete information or using inappropriate language in your articles.
